#e69924 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e69924 is composed of 90.2% red, 60% green and 14.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.5% magenta, 84.3%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 36.2 degrees, a saturation of 79.5% and a lightness of 52.2%. #e69924 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ff48 with #cd3300.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

#e69924 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e69924 has RGB values of R:230, G:153, B:36 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.84,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15112484.

Hex triplet e69924 #e69924
RGB Decimal 230, 153, 36 rgb(230,153,36)
RGB Percent 90.2, 60, 14.1 rgb(90.2%,60%,14.1%)
CMYK 0, 33, 84, 10
HSL 36.2°, 79.5, 52.2 hsl(36.2,79.5%,52.2%)
HSV (or HSB) 36.2°, 84.3, 90.2
Web Safe ff9933 #ff9933
CIE-LAB 69.281, 20.204, 66.903
XYZ 44.344, 39.736, 7.003
xyY 0.487, 0.436, 39.736
CIE-LCH 69.281, 69.887, 73.196
CIE-LUV 69.281, 63.357, 65.186
Hunter-Lab 63.036, 15.255, 37.538
Binary 11100110, 10011001, 00100100

Shades and Tints of #e69924

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0601 is the darkest color, while #fefb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e69924

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#888682 is the less saturated color, while #f99d11 is the most saturated one.
